Connecting to a Video Source for Sound

You can play sound through the projector's speaker system if your video source has audio output ports.

If you are projecting video using a Computer port, connect the projector to the video source using an optional stereo mini-jack audio cable or an RCA audio cable.

If you are projecting video using the Video port, connect the projector to the video source using an RCA audio cable.

  1. Connect the audio cable to your video source's audio-out ports.
  2. Do one of the following:
    • Connect the other end of the cable to the projector's Audio port that corresponds to the Computer port you are using for video.
    • Connect the red and white plugs on the other end of the cable to the projector's L-Audio-R ports.
